PURPOSE:To improve the capability to detect a foreign matter by using the X-ray sensor which emits X-ray, transmitted through a body to be inspected, by a scintillator formed by mixing glass beads and fluorescent bodies, then converts the light into an electric signal by a photoelectric converting element. CONSTITUTION:The body to be inspected which is conveyed in the X-ray irradiated zone of the pipe line 6a in a sanitary pipe line 6 is irradiated with X rays from an X-ray device 1 and the X rays are made incident on the X-ray line sensor 2a. Then the sensor 2a converts the X rays which are transmitted through the body to be inspected into visible light by the scintillator 200 applied to the photoelectric converting element 21 and this visible light is converted by a photodiode array into an electric signal, which is outputted. At this time, the light which is converted from the X rays to the visible light by fluorescent material powder 202 of the scintillator 200 is propagated in the glass beads 201 before being absorbed or attenuated, then made incident on the element 21. Then the electric signal from the sensor 2a is inputted to a processor 3 and processed to detect foreign matter in the body to be inspected. Then the processor 3 supplies a specific command based upon the processing result to a flow passage switching mechanism 4. |
